WebNov 16, 2024 · Essentially, bunion surgeries can fail in the following circumstances, each discussed below: the deformity is not fully corrected and hallux valgus persists or recurs. the deformity is overcorrected into varus. the bone doesn’t heal, resulting in a nonunion. the bone heals in the wrong position, creating a malunion. WebFeb 22, 2024 · Initial recovery from bunion surgery takes around 6 weeks. During this timeframe, your foot will begin to heal from the surgical incision. Pain and swelling decrease, and you will start to regain mobility. Before we look more at bunion surgery recovery, we need to address two caveats. Everyone’s body is different.
